Marklo has been identified by the anthropologist H. H. Howarth with the village of Markenah in the district of Hoya near Heiligen Ioh, a "sacred wood" and Adelshorn in Lower Saxony. It seems Howarth really did write that: . But: there's no place called Markenah, there's no place called Adelshorn, and Heiligenloh is not in the district Hoya nor close to the Weser.
